如今,随着互联网技术的飞速发展,越来越多的人选择将自己的网站或应用程序托管在云服务器上。对于初学者来说,阿里云提供的学生VPS(虚拟私有服务器)是一个非常不错的选择,它不仅价格实惠,而且性能稳定。本文将详细介绍如何在阿里云学生VPS上安装和配置LAMP环境。
LAMP环境简介
LAMP是一种常见的Web开发平台架构,由Linux操作系统、Apache HTTP服务器、MySQL数据库管理系统以及PHP编程语言组成。这种组合为开发者提供了强大的后端支持,适用于构建各种类型的动态网站和Web应用。
准备工作
在开始安装之前,请确保您已经完成了以下步骤:
1. 注册并登录阿里云账号。
2. 购买一台学生专享的ECS实例(即VPS),推荐选择CentOS 7.x版本作为操作系统。
3. 记录下VPS的公网IP地址、用户名(root)及密码等信息。
4. 使用SSH工具(如PuTTY)连接到您的VPS。
更新系统软件包
为了保证后续安装过程顺利进行,在正式安装LAMP组件之前,建议先对现有系统中的所有软件包进行更新。执行命令:
yum update -y
安装Apache服务器
接下来我们将安装Apache Web服务器。通过YUM源可以直接获取官方最新版的Apache服务程序。输入如下命令:
yum install httpd -y
安装完成后,启动Apache服务,并设置开机自启:
systemctl start httpd
systemctl enable httpd
现在,打开浏览器并访问您VPS的公网IP地址,如果看到“Test Page for Apache”页面,则说明Apache已成功运行。
安装MariaDB数据库
MariaDB是MySQL的一个分支版本,两者兼容性良好,性能更优。我们可以用下面的指令来安装:
yum install mariadb-server -y
同样地,启动MariaDB服务并设置开机自启:
systemctl start mariadb
systemctl enable mariadb
初次使用时需要对其进行安全初始化配置:
mysql_secure_installation
安装PHP解释器
最后一步就是安装PHP了。这里我们采用Remi仓库中的最新稳定版:
yum install epel-release -y
yum install remi-release -y
yum-config-manager --enable remi-php74
yum install php php-mysql -y
重启Apache以加载新的PHP模块:
systemctl restart httpd
测试PHP功能
创建一个简单的PHP文件用于验证是否正确安装了PHP解析引擎。编辑/var/www/html/index.php:
保存更改后再次刷新浏览器,如果显示出了关于PHP的信息页面,恭喜你!整个LAMP环境搭建工作就全部完成了。
以上就是在阿里云学生VPS上安装和配置LAMP环境的具体方法。希望这篇文章能够帮助到每一位想要学习Linux服务器管理或者Web开发的新手朋友们。实际操作过程中可能会遇到各种问题,但只要耐心排查错误原因,多查阅资料,相信一定能顺利完成任务。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/122747.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。